Why choose one over the other?
Reasons to choose Gotrax G4
- •Higher top speed of 32.2 km/h versus 20 km/h on the G2 Pro
- •Lighter weight at 16.8 kg compared to 22.3 kg for easier carrying and storage
- •Larger 10" wheels versus 9" wheels for improved ride comfort
Reasons to choose KuKirin G2 Pro
- •Longer range of 65 km versus 40.2 km on the G4
- •Bigger 749 Wh battery capacity compared to 374 Wh for extended use
- •Dual disc brakes front and rear versus only rear disc on the G4
- •Higher IP54 water resistance rating versus IPX4 on the G4

📝 Our Verdict
The Gotrax G4 is best for riders who prioritize speed, portability, and a smoother ride on shorter urban commutes. The KuKirin G2 Pro suits those needing longer range, stronger braking performance, and enhanced weather protection for longer or more varied trips.
